第1章Nginx快速入門
了解Nginx、
安裝Nginx、
Nginx基礎(chǔ)目錄結(jié)構(gòu)
常用模塊
常用變量
第2章Nginx常用模塊
日志模塊
狀態(tài)模塊
下載站點模塊
用戶登錄授信
IP訪問控制
連接限制、請求限制
第3章Nginx提供靜態(tài)資源WEB服務(wù)
靜態(tài)資源壓縮、
瀏覽器緩存、
跨域請求訪問、
防盜鏈
第4章Nginx提供代理服務(wù)
HTTP代理、
正向代理、
反向代理
第5章Nginx提供負(fù)載均衡
負(fù)載均衡
構(gòu)建應(yīng)用層負(fù)載均衡
構(gòu)建傳輸層負(fù)載均衡
使用阿里云構(gòu)建應(yīng)用層與傳輸層負(fù)載均衡
動靜分離
動態(tài)請求與靜態(tài)請求分離
實現(xiàn)資源請求分離與分類
第6章Nginx提供ProxyCache緩存服務(wù)
客戶端緩存、
代理緩存、
應(yīng)用緩存、
緩存清理
第7章Nginx Rewrite跳轉(zhuǎn)規(guī)則與實踐
rewrite跳轉(zhuǎn)與重定向使用場景、
永久跳轉(zhuǎn)、
臨時跳轉(zhuǎn)
break與last
第8章Nginx HTTPS服務(wù)
使用阿里云構(gòu)建蘋果官方標(biāo)準(zhǔn)的HTTTPS Web服務(wù)
第9章Nginx構(gòu)建動態(tài)網(wǎng)站架構(gòu)lnmp/lnmt
構(gòu)建主流LNMP架構(gòu)、LNMT架構(gòu)
第10章Nginx+Lua實戰(zhàn)
Lua基本語法
Nginx+Lua集成
測試集成Lua腳本
Nginx+Lua構(gòu)建灰度發(fā)布場景
Nginx+Lua構(gòu)建防SQL注入、防CC突發(fā)流量攻擊
第11章Nginx性能優(yōu)化與壓測工具
系統(tǒng)Nginx調(diào)優(yōu)、
Nginx性能調(diào)優(yōu)、
Nginx通用配置文件
第12章Nginx常見問題
root與alias區(qū)別
多server優(yōu)先級
多l(xiāng)ocation優(yōu)先級
http返回狀態(tài)碼
禁止IP直接訪問網(wǎng)站
網(wǎng)站訪問流程、pv、uv、ip、
第13章Nginx架構(gòu)總結(jié)
分析需求、
評估需求、
配置注意事項
第1章Nginx快速入門
1-1Nginx基礎(chǔ)概述
1-2Nginx特性1
1-3Nginx特性2
1-4Nginx安裝
1-5Nginx目錄結(jié)構(gòu)概述與編譯參數(shù)概述
1-6Nginx常用模塊
1-7Nginx常用變量
1-8Nginx狀態(tài)碼概述
1-9Nginx主配置文件概述
第2章Nginx常用模塊
2-1Nginx日志模塊
2-2Nginx狀態(tài)監(jiān)控模塊
2-3Nginx作為下載站點模塊
2-4Nginx請求限制模塊
2-5Nginx請求限制補充
2-6Nginx連接限制模塊
2-7Nginx訪問控制模塊
2-8Nginx訪問控制局限
2-9Nginx用戶認(rèn)證模塊
2-10Nginx用戶認(rèn)證局限
2-11Nginx虛擬主機-port
2-12Nginx虛擬主機注意事項
第3章Nginx提供靜態(tài)資源WEB服務(wù)
3-1靜態(tài)資源概述
3-2靜態(tài)資源配置語法
3-3靜態(tài)資源壓縮實戰(zhàn)案例
3-4靜態(tài)資源壓縮實戰(zhàn)案例2
3-5瀏覽器緩存概述
3-6瀏覽器緩存實戰(zhàn)案例
3-7靜態(tài)資源跨域訪問
3-8靜態(tài)資源防盜鏈
3-9靜態(tài)資源小結(jié)
第4章Nginx提供代理服務(wù)
4-1Nginx代理基本概述
4-2Nginx代理配置語法
4-3Nginx正向代理配置實例
4-4Nginx反向代理準(zhǔn)備-購買aliyun
4-5Nginx反向代理配置實例
第5章Nginx提供負(fù)載均衡
5-1Nginx負(fù)載均衡概述
5-2Nginx負(fù)載均衡配置語法
5-3Nginx負(fù)載均衡場景實戰(zhàn)
5-4Nginx負(fù)載均衡狀態(tài)模塊
5-5Nginx負(fù)載均衡調(diào)度策略
5-6Nginx負(fù)載均衡TCP配置場景
5-7阿里云SLB實踐HTTP與TCP場景
5-8Nginx動靜分離概述
5-9Nginx動靜分離場景-配置靜態(tài)站點
5-10Nginx動靜分離-配置動態(tài)站點
5-11Nginx動靜分離-本地虛擬機場景實戰(zhàn)
5-12Nginx動靜分離-按手機類型調(diào)度不同后端節(jié)點
5-13Nginx動靜分離-按瀏覽器調(diào)度不同后端節(jié)點
5-14Nginx負(fù)載均衡總結(jié)
第6章Nginx提供ProxyCache緩存服務(wù)
6-1Nginx緩存概述
6-2Nginx緩存配置語法
6-3Nginx緩存配置案例
6-4Nginx清理緩存方式
6-5Nginx部分頁面不緩存
6-6Nginx緩存總結(jié)
第7章Nginx Rewrite跳轉(zhuǎn)規(guī)則與實踐
7-1Nginx Rewrite基本概述
7-2Nginx Rewrite配置語法
7-3Nginx Rewrite標(biāo)記Flag實踐1
7-4Nginx Rewrite標(biāo)記Flag實踐2
7-5Nginx Rewrite實戰(zhàn)案例上
7-6Nginx Rewrite實戰(zhàn)案例下
7-7Nginx Rewrite補充
第8章Nginx構(gòu)建Https加密傳輸網(wǎng)站(基于IOS蘋果要求)
8-1Nginx Https基本概述
8-2Nginx Https配置實戰(zhàn)
8-3公有云配置蘋果要求Https加密證書
8-4Nginx Http強制跳轉(zhuǎn)Https
第9章Nginx構(gòu)建動態(tài)網(wǎng)站架構(gòu)lnmp/lnmt
9-1安裝LNMP架構(gòu)
9-2配置LNMP架構(gòu)
9-3PHP原理與優(yōu)化
9-4安裝Tomcat
9-5配置Nginx+Tomacat組合
第10章Nginx+Lua-實戰(zhàn)代碼灰度發(fā)布實戰(zhàn)-WAF防火墻
10-1Lua基本概述
10-2配置Nginx支持Lua環(huán)境
10-3Nginx調(diào)用Lua相關(guān)指令
10-4Nginx+Lua實戰(zhàn)灰度發(fā)布場景演示1
10-5Nginx+Lua實戰(zhàn)灰度發(fā)布場景演示2
10-6Nginx安全-基本安全概述
10-7Nginx安全-演示sql場景準(zhǔn)備
10-8Nginx安全-Nginx+Lua構(gòu)建waf防火墻攔截
10-9Nginx安全-Nginx+Lua構(gòu)建waf防火墻攔截CC
第11章Nginx性能優(yōu)化與壓測工具
11-1Nginx性能優(yōu)化-概述
11-2Nginx性能優(yōu)化-需考慮點
11-3Nginx性能優(yōu)化-壓力測試工具ab
11-4Nginx性能指標(biāo)-影響性能優(yōu)化指標(biāo)
11-5Nginx性能優(yōu)化-文件描述符調(diào)整
11-6Nginx性能優(yōu)化-CPU親和
11-7Nginx性能優(yōu)化-通用Nginx配置模板文件
第12章Nginx常見問題
12-1Nginx常見問題-多Server優(yōu)先級
12-2Nginx常見問題-多Location優(yōu)先級
12-3Nginx常見問題-tryfile使用
12-4Nginx常見問題-root與alias區(qū)別
12-5Nginx常見問題-獲取真實客戶端IP
12-6Nginx常見問題-http返回狀態(tài)碼
12-7Nginx常見問題-網(wǎng)站ip、pv、uv
12-8Nginx常見問題-網(wǎng)站訪問流程
第13章Nginx架構(gòu)總結(jié)
13-1Nginx架構(gòu)設(shè)計-了解需求
13-2Nginx架構(gòu)設(shè)計-評估需求
13-3Nginx架構(gòu)設(shè)計-配置注意事項 |